Common Myths About Offplan Properties in Dubai
Myth 1: Offplan Properties Are Always Risky Investments
Reality: While there are inherent risks in any investment, offplan properties in Dubai are often backed by reputable developers. Due diligence, including evaluating the developer’s history and project viability, can mitigate risks effectively.
Myth 2: You Can’t Resell Offplan Properties
Reality: Many buyers of offplan properties in Dubai can resell their contracts before the completion of the project. This practice, known as flipping, can be lucrative if market conditions are favorable.
Myth 3: Offplan Properties Are Always Cheaper Than Ready Properties
Reality: While offplan properties may offer better pricing at launch, prices can rise significantly during the construction phase. It’s essential to compare the total costs, including potential appreciation, to determine value.
Myth 4: All Offplan Developments Are the Same
Reality: The market features a diverse range of offplan developments. From luxury high-rises to villa communities, options vary significantly in terms of amenities, location, and price point.
Myth 5: You Have to Pay Full Price Upfront
Reality: Many developers offer flexible payment plans for offplan properties, allowing buyers to make installments throughout the construction phase. This approach can ease financial burdens for investors.
Myth 6: Offplan Properties Won’t Appreciate in Value
Reality: Historical data shows that many offplan properties in Dubai appreciate significantly by the time they are completed, particularly in sought-after areas. Market trends and location are key factors influencing value.
Myth 7: Investors Have No Control Over the Investment
Reality: Investors can actively participate by choosing designs, finishes, and even layouts in some developments. This level of involvement can enhance the property’s appeal when it comes time to sell or rent.
What Buyers and Investors Should Focus On
When considering luxury offplan properties in Dubai, potential buyers and investors should focus on several critical aspects:
- Developer Reputation: Research the track record and credibility of the developer.
- Location: Assess the neighborhood’s growth potential, amenities, and accessibility.
- Market Trends: Stay informed about market conditions and future developments in the area.
- Payment Plans: Understand the payment structure and any incentives offered by the developer.
- Legal Considerations: Ensure clarity on contracts, ownership rights, and any associated fees.
